Jahangir Tareen – a profile


Jahangir Tareen, considered one of the wealthiest legislators of Pakistan, was disqualified on Friday by the Supreme Court from holding public office for not being entirely truthful about the ownership of a property in London. Tareen had started his political career in 2002 after being elected to the National Assembly on a PML-Q ticket. In 2004, Tareen was inducted into the federal cabinet and served as a minister with the portfolio of industries, production and special initiatives under former president Pervez Musharraf.
